South Africa's Social Relief of Distress (SRD) Grant, usually known as the R350 grant due to its regular monthly payout, is really a lifeline for many vulnerable people today within the nation.

The South African Social Security Agency (SASSA) is liable for this initiative, targeted at supplying momentary financial aid to those in severe economical need.

1. Exactly what is the SRD Grant?

The SRD Grant, managed by SASSA, is a temporary provision of aid intended for individuals in such dire material need that they are struggling to meet up with their or their people' most basic demands. This grant was significantly highlighted through the COVID-19 pandemic as a way that will help those facing excessive financial hardship.

2. That's Suitable?

To qualify for the SRD grant:

You need to become a South African citizen, copyright, or refugee registered on the Home Affairs database.
You will need to be at present residing in the borders of South Africa.
You will need to be higher than the age of 18.
You should be unemployed.
You need to not be receiving any method of cash flow.
You should not be receiving any social grant.
You will need to not be obtaining any unemployment insurance benefit and would not qualify to get unemployment insurance policy Positive aspects.

You should not be obtaining a stipend from your National sassa payment dates Student Financial Aid Scheme NSFAS or other financial aid.
You need to not be residing inside a government-funded or subsidized institution.

3. How to Apply?

Applications for the SRD grant can be carried out by a variety of methods:

Online Platform: SASSA includes a dedicated on-line System wherever applications might be submitted. Ensure you have all demanded documents ready for upload.

WhatsApp: There is a devoted SASSA WhatsApp selection for SRD grant apps. Stick to the prompts once you initiate a chat.

SMS/ USSD: You may use a particular code supplied by SASSA to use by means of SMS or USSD. This method may well entail expenses associated with your community provider.

Email: You can find also an choice to email your application. Be certain all necessary documentation is attached.

Remember, It truly is essential to give precise and comprehensive data when making use of. Misrepresentation may perhaps lead to disqualification or lawful steps.
